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
601 2212 77052 5230 3539928931
9436 18
9436 18
903 8263 3035004897
All about undefined
Interested in learning more?
9436 18
903 8263 3035004897
See more
909468447 5798 78048
6277952229 54 257
See more
52081377239 9923272825
0690 53 1576039
See more